**CI note: timezone weirdness in report exports**

Heads up, support folks — if a customer says their Ledgerpine export shows times shifted by a few hours, it's probably the CI image. The export workers got rebuilt last week and the base image defaults to UTC, while older workers used the account's locale. Fix is rolling out; meanwhile tell customers the data itself is fine, just the display offset. Affected exports carry the build token shown below.

build token for bajof-tahop: htk4_a981

- [ ] **Step 7: Breaker override escrow.** After sealing the signing keys for the Tallgrove upstream API circuit breaker, confirm the support team can force the breaker open during a full outage. The override bundle lives in the sealed escrow drawer and is useless without its unlock phrase. Two ceremony witnesses must initial this step before proceeding. The escrow bundle is decrypted with the recovery passphrase that follows.

vault phrase of kahip-kahop = holath-quenmir

### v3.2.0 — setting renamed

Heads up, plugin authors: in the Inkrelay spooler service, `SPOOL_AUTH` is now `INKRELAY_SPOOL_TOKEN`. Same behavior, clearer name, and it no longer clashes with the legacy Paperchute bridge. The old name still works until v4.0 but logs a deprecation warning on every print job, which gets noisy fast. Update your plugin's `.env` now — put the renamed token value on the very next line.

vault entry, kafog-yahop: COURIER_KEY8=0faa53ae

## Build Provenance: ScanBridge Integration

Every ScanBridge barcode-scanner build at Quillmark Systems is produced by the Lanternworks pipeline, which records the source revision, toolchain version, and signing certificate in a provenance manifest. New team members should never accept a binary from chat or shared drives; only artifacts from the pipeline registry are trusted. Before deploying to a warehouse kiosk, verify the manifest signature and confirm it matches the trace token shown below.

pipeline stamp: htk9_ce63042d9